5182 Aluminum Body Panel

Deformed aluminum alloys are mainly used in automobiles to manufacture body panels such as doors and trunks, bumpers, engine covers, wheel spokes, hub covers, wheel exterior covers, protective covers for brake assemblies, mufflers, and anti-lock brakes.

At present, 5xxx aluminum alloys are widely used for the inner panels for automobiles such as 5052 and 5182 aluminum body panel. In terms of deep drawing performance and tensile strength, 5052 aluminum alloy is far inferior to 5182 alloy. Therefore, the preferred aluminum alloy material for complex deep-drawing inner panels of automobiles is 5182-O thin aluminum sheet.

Application advantages of aluminum alloys in automobiles

1. Lightweight vehicles, energy saving and consumption reduction, and environmentally friendly.

2. The recycling rate of automotive aluminum alloy parts is high.

3. Aluminum alloy cars reduce the weight of the car without reducing the capacity of the car. The center of gravity of the body is lowered, and the car is more stable and comfortable to drive. Due to the performance of the aluminum alloy material and the structure of the body, it can fully absorb the energy of the impact, so it is safer.

4. The use of aluminum alloys reduces the process and improves the assembly efficiency. The overall structure of the aluminum alloy car has fewer solder joints, which reduces the processing procedures. The overall aluminum alloy body is about 35% lighter than the welded steel body, and no anti-rust treatment is required. Only 25% to 35% of the parts need spot welding, which can greatly improve the assembly efficiency of the car.

5. It improves the fuel efficiency and increase load capacity.

The first aluminum alloys used in Europe and the United States on the car body are 2036 and 5182. The United States uses high-strength 2016 aluminum alloy on the outer body of the car body, and 5182 aluminum alloy with good formability on the inner plate parts. However, due to the poor formability and corrosion resistance of 2000 series alloys, Europe and the United States began to focus on the development of 6000 series alloys.

The first is the 6009 and 6010 bake-hardening alloys. After T4 treatment, they have good plasticity. After forming, they can be artificially aged and strengthened by spraying and baking to obtain higher strength (aging can increase their yield strength by nearly 100%). 6009 alloy can reach 241MPa, and the 6010 alloy plate can reach 310MPa.

At present, they have been widely used in the inner and outer panels of automobiles. Later, by improving the performance, 6111, 6016, 6022 and other aluminum alloys with good comprehensive performance for automobiles have been developed on their basis.

In China, the yield strength of 5182 h111 is between 115~125MPa, the tensile strength reaches 260~270MPa, the elongation after breaking (A80mm) can reach more than 27%, and the uniform elongation is more than 24%.

The yield strength of 6016-T4P automobile outer panel is between 100~110MPa, the tensile strength reaches 210~220MPa, the elongation after fracture (A80mm) can reach more than 27%, and the uniform elongation is more than 22.5%. After production verification, the product performance is stable, and the performance of 5182-O automotive inner panels meets the requirements of automotive panels.
